Toshiba Announces Breakthrough Lithium-Ion Battery with Ultra-Fast Recharging and Enhanced Performance

Today, Toshiba Corporation unveiled a groundbreaking advancement in lithium-ion battery technology that promises to revolutionize the market with its unprecedented recharge times and enhanced performance. The new battery can recharge 80% of its energy capacity in just one minute, approximately 60 times faster than the typical lithium-ion batteries currently in use. This rapid recharge time is coupled with significant improvements in energy density, offering both efficiency and convenience. The innovation lies in Toshiba’s latest advancements in nano-material technology, specifically applied to the negative electrode. The new battery uses nano-particles to prevent the reduction of organic liquid electrolytes during recharging. These nano-particles are capable of absorbing and storing large amounts of lithium ions quickly, without causing deterioration to the electrode. Additionally, the battery boasts a long life cycle, retaining 99% of its capacity even after 1,000 cycles of discharging and recharging. It also performs reliably in extreme temperatures, discharging 80% of its capacity at minus 40 degrees centigrade and maintaining excellent performance at high temperatures up to 45 degrees centigrade. Toshiba plans to commercialize this revolutionary battery in 2006, targeting the automotive and industrial sectors initially. The slim, small-sized battery is ideal for hybrid electric vehicles due to its high energy output and rapid recharge capability. Toshiba anticipates that the battery’s high energy density and superior recharge performance will make it a key energy solution in various applications, from vehicles to mobile devices. This new eco-friendly battery also supports CO2 reduction by efficiently storing and reusing energy that was previously wasted, contributing to a more sustainable future.
